Outsourcing Jobs to Foreign Countries: A Comprehensive Analysis Outsourcing jobs to foreign countries has become one of the most significant trends in the business world today. While some argue that the practice is beneficial to the economy, others argue that it causes job losses and undermines local industries. In this article, we will explore the topic of outsourcing jobs to foreign countries, discussing both the positive and negative aspects of the practice. What is Outsourcing? Outsourcing is the practice of hiring an external company to take over a particular business function that was previously done in-house. This can include anything from customer service to manufacturing. Outsourcing is often done to reduce costs, improve efficiency, and gain access to specialized skills and talents that may not be available in-house. Outsourcing Jobs to Foreign Countries Outsourcing jobs to foreign countries, also known as offshoring, is when a company hires a foreign company or individual to perform work that was previously done in-house. The practice has become increasingly popular in recent years, particularly in the manufacturing and service industries. The Benefits of Outsourcing Jobs to Foreign Countries One of the main benefits of outsourcing jobs to foreign countries is cost savings. Many developing countries offer lower labor costs, which can significantly reduce the cost of production. This can be particularly advantageous for companies that operate in high-wage countries such as the United States and Europe. Another benefit of outsourcing jobs to foreign countries is increased efficiency. Many developing countries have a large pool of skilled workers who are willing to work longer hours for lower wages. This can lead to increased productivity and faster turnaround times, which can be beneficial to companies that need to meet tight deadlines. In addition to cost savings and increased efficiency, outsourcing jobs to foreign countries can also provide access to specialized skills and talents that may not be available in-house. For example, some developing countries have a strong focus on science and technology, which can provide companies with access to cutting-edge research and development. The Drawbacks of Outsourcing Jobs to Foreign Countries Despite the benefits of outsourcing jobs to foreign countries, there are also significant drawbacks to the practice. One of the main drawbacks is job losses. When companies outsource jobs to foreign countries, they often lay off workers in their home country, which can lead to increased unemployment and economic instability. Another drawback of outsourcing jobs to foreign countries is the potential for quality issues. When companies outsource work to foreign countries, they are often relying on workers who may not have the same level of training and expertise as in-house staff. This can lead to quality issues and customer dissatisfaction, which can ultimately hurt the company's reputation and bottom line. In addition to job losses and quality issues, outsourcing jobs to foreign countries can also lead to cultural and communication barriers. Workers in developing countries may not be familiar with the customs and practices of their clients' home countries, which can lead to misunderstandings and communication breakdowns. The Impact of Outsourcing Jobs to Foreign Countries The impact of outsourcing jobs to foreign countries is a complex issue that has been the subject of much debate. Supporters of outsourcing argue that it can lead to increased efficiency and cost savings, which can ultimately benefit the economy. Critics of outsourcing, however, argue that it can lead to job losses and economic instability, particularly in high-wage countries. One of the most significant impacts of outsourcing jobs to foreign countries is the shifting of employment from high-wage countries to low-wage countries. This can lead to increased unemployment and economic instability in high-wage countries, particularly in industries that have been heavily impacted by outsourcing. Another impact of outsourcing jobs to foreign countries is the potential for cultural and communication barriers. As mentioned earlier, workers in developing countries may not be familiar with the customs and practices of their clients' home countries, which can lead to misunderstandings and communication breakdowns. Conclusion Outsourcing jobs to foreign countries is a complex issue that has both positive and negative aspects. While the practice can lead to cost savings and increased efficiency, it can also lead to job losses and economic instability. Ultimately, the decision of whether to outsource jobs to foreign countries should be based on a careful analysis of the costs and benefits, as well as the potential impact on employees and the economy as a whole.

Part-time Jobs in Swinton South Yorkshire Swinton is a small town located in South Yorkshire, England, and is situated about 5 miles from Rotherham and 8 miles from Sheffield. The town has a population of more than 15,000 people and is home to various industries and businesses, including retail, healthcare, education, and manufacturing. As a result, there are numerous part-time job opportunities available in Swinton, making it an ideal location for job seekers looking for flexible working hours. In this article, we will take a closer look at the different types of part-time jobs available in Swinton, the benefits of working part-time, and how to find part-time job opportunities in the town. Types of Part-time Jobs in Swinton Swinton has a diverse range of part-time job opportunities available for job seekers. Here are some of the most common types of part-time jobs in Swinton: 1. Retail Jobs Retail jobs are one of the most common types of part-time jobs available in Swinton. The town has several retail stores, including supermarkets, clothing stores, and department stores. Retail jobs can range from sales assistants to cashiers, and the hours can be flexible, making it an ideal choice for students or those who have other commitments during the week. 2. Healthcare Jobs Swinton has several healthcare facilities, including hospitals, clinics, and care homes. Healthcare jobs can range from support workers to nurses and doctors. These jobs may require some qualifications and experience, but there are also entry-level roles available that provide on-the-job training. 3. Education Jobs Swinton has several schools and colleges, which means there are numerous opportunities available for part-time teachers, teaching assistants, and administrative staff. Education jobs can be ideal for those who are passionate about helping others learn and develop their skills. 4. Manufacturing Jobs Swinton is home to several manufacturing companies, including those that produce engineering equipment, automotive parts, and consumer goods. Manufacturing jobs can range from assembly line workers to machine operators, and many of these jobs offer flexible working hours.
